The Clorox Company reports news on a broad consumer-products portfolio spanning cleaning supplies, laundry care, trash bags, cat litter, charcoal, food dressings, water filtration and personal care. Company updates commonly cover quarterly results, outlook revisions, margin drivers, cost savings, manufacturing and logistics costs, and portfolio investment across brands such as Clorox, Glad, Pine-Sol, Fresh Step, Kingsford, Hidden Valley, Brita and Burt's Bees.

Clorox news also includes product launches and brand extensions, including Hidden Valley Ranch foods and seasonings, Burt's Bees personal-care products, Kingsford grilling products and household cleaning innovations. Corporate updates cover dividends, board and governance matters, and completed portfolio actions such as the GOJO Industries acquisition, which added Purell and health and hygiene solutions.

CloroxPro has launched the EcoClean™ platform, a new line of environmentally friendly cleaners and disinfectants designed for professional use. This product line includes EPA-certified disinfectant and all-purpose cleaners made with up to 99% plant-based ingredients. EcoClean products effectively kill 99.9% of germs in under two minutes and meet high safety standards for human health and the environment. Consumer surveys indicate a significant demand for eco-conscious cleaning solutions in public spaces. Clorox aims to enhance sustainability in cleaning practices while maintaining efficacy.

The Clorox Company (NYSE: CLX) reported flat net sales of $1.8 billion for Q4 FY2022, with organic sales up 1%. Gross margin remained stable at 37.1%. Diluted EPS grew 4% to 81 cents, though adjusted EPS fell 2% to 93 cents. The company faces challenges from ongoing inflation and market normalization but has launched a streamlined operating model expected to save $75-$100 million annually. For FY2023, Clorox anticipates a 4% decline to a 2% rise in net sales and a diluted EPS range of $3.10 to $3.47, reflecting continued investment in brand and digital capabilities.

The Clorox Company (NYSE: CLX) has declared a 2% increase in its quarterly dividend, raising it from $1.16 to $1.18 per share. The dividend will be payable on August 12, 2022, to shareholders recorded by the close of business on July 27, 2022. Clorox has a strong history of returning value to shareholders, having increased its dividend for 20 consecutive years and maintained annual dividends for over 50 years.

In fiscal year 2021, Clorox reported sales of $7.3 billion, with over 80% of its sales generated from brands holding top market positions.

The Clorox Company (NYSE: CLX) has joined the Responsible Flushing Alliance alongside GOJO Industries to enhance consumer awareness regarding proper disposal habits through the #FlushSmart campaign. This initiative coincides with California's inaugural Flush Smart Day on July 1, promoting the 'Do Not Flush' symbol on packaging of single-use cleaning products. Clorox aims to promote health and safety by encouraging responsible disposal practices, while GOJO emphasizes improving hygiene solutions. The RFA continues to grow, inviting more industry stakeholders to contribute.

The Clorox Company (NYSE: CLX) announced the appointment of Julia Denman and Stephanie Plaines to its board of directors on May 18, 2022. Denman brings nearly 30 years of financial leadership experience from Microsoft and Procter & Gamble, while Plaines has over 30 years in finance, having worked with PepsiCo and Walmart. Their appointments expand the board from 11 to 13 members, enhancing its diversity with 46% female and 30% people of color representation. Both will serve on the audit committee.
